Leukocytoid refers to a type of cell that resembles a white blood cell (leukocyte) in appearance, but is not actually a true white blood cell. These cells can be found in various conditions, including benign or malignant neoplasms, and their resemblance to leukocytes can sometimes lead to misdiagnosis.
